Originally founded in 1991 as Harlem RBI, DREAM has grown to annually serve more than 2,500 youth across East Harlem and the South Bronx through a network of six PreK-12, extended-day, extended-year DREAM Charter Schools and community sports-based youth development programs. Through our commitment to rigorous academics, social-emotional learning, deep family and community engagement, and health and wellness, we create lifelong learners who are equipped to fulfill their vision of success in and out of the classroom. We dream big, as well, with an aggressive five-year plan to expand to serve 3,500 students across seven schools-growing our organization's impact and leveling the playing field for all children. DREAM (formerly Harlem RBI), an award winning sports-based youth development program, is seeking dynamic individuals to serve as as After School Youth Workers in our elementary (REAL Kids) program in East Harlem and the South Bronx.

The Youth Worker will lead a group of 18-20 elementary-aged students daily in activities including sports, social-emotional learning, enrichment, and academic support programming.

Youth Workers will have the opportunity to participate in professional development training, in addition to receiving regular feedback and support. This is an excellent opportunity to build your youth development skills while working with a passionate and supportive team.

Responsibilities

    • Lead a group of up to 18-20 youth in daily after-school activities including sports, social-emotional learning, enrichment and academic support;
    • Facilitate or co-facilitate lessons to help youth build their social and emotional skills;
    • Collaborate with team to plan & facilitate various enrichment activities;
    • Support with homework completion and other academic enrichment;
    • Model and encourage positive participation in all daily activities, with a focus on team building;
    • Model professionalism through consistent attendance, timeliness and preparation;
    • Supervise and manage youth behavior at all times using positive youth development strategies;
    • Participate in weekly professional development and tactical training in addition to formal feedback and coaching;
    • Implement all health and safety protocols as required;
    • Using a restorative approach to manage student behaviors;
    • Youth workers placed at DREAM Highbridge only: Supervise and assist students' transition between school attire and swimwear;
    • Youth workers placed at DREAM Highbridge only: Assist New Settlement lifeguards and swim instructors with behavior/class management during aquatic activities, including entering the pool with youth;
